Job SummaryThe PCN Care Co-ordinator plays an important role within a PCN to proactively identify and work with people to provide coordination and navigation of care and support across health and care services.The postholder will deliver NHS Health Checks in line with national guidance and provide administrative follow-up to ensure continuity of care. They will also support general hub coordination and front, patient navigation, and population health initiatives.The role includes participation in a rota covering extended access hours to include two weekday evenings (currently Wednesday and Thursday until 8 pm) andSaturdays (9am 5pm)Main duties of the jobNHS Health Check DeliveryDeliver NHS Health Checks for eligible patients, carrying our near point of care testing, including lifestyle assessments, and cardiovascular risk scoring. Provide brief interventions and health promotion advice tailored to individual risk profiles. Accurately document clinical data in patient records using appropriate systems.Administrative Follow-UpManage post-check communications, including results, follow-up bookings, and referrals. Ensure accurate coding and data entry in line with NHS Health Check programme requirements. Support reporting and audit processes to maintain service qualityCare Coordination & Hub SupportAct as first point of contact for patients accessing the Health & Wellbeing Hub (face-to-face, phone, email). Book patients into appropriate services and signpost to community resources. Promote hub services and events, including via social media platforms.Teamwork & Rota CommitmentWork collaboratively within the Care Co-ordinator team, supporting shared goals and mutual learning. Participate in extended access rota, including evenings and Saturdays. Ensure consistent service delivery across all sessions.Service Development & GovernanceMaintain accurate records and adhere to data protection and safeguarding policies. Support delivery of PCN Network DES, enhanced services, and population health initiatives.About UsBridgwater Bay Primary Care Network (PCN) is the largest PCN in Somerset with 9 GP practices supporting 85,000 patients from a diverse population spread across town and rural locations.As a PCN we are forward thinking, innovate and driven to deliver the best patient care for our population. This includes health population management, and this role ties in with supporting that and tracking the improvements we can make to patients lives.
